Park Landscape Maintenance in Ventura County, CA
Park landscape maintenance services encompass a range of tasks aimed at keeping outdoor spaces healthy, attractive, and well-kept. These services typically include lawn mowing, edging, trimming shrubs, pruning trees, and removing debris to ensure a tidy appearance. Property owners often request these services to maintain the visual appeal of their yards, prepare for seasonal changes, or uphold safety standards by preventing overgrown vegetation. It’s helpful to understand the scope of work involved, the frequency of maintenance visits, and any specific plant or lawn care requirements before requesting services.
Homeowners considering landscape maintenance should also consider the size and complexity of their property, as well as any special features such as flower beds, irrigation systems, or hardscape elements. Clarifying these details can help determine the appropriate level of service needed and ensure the property remains healthy and visually appealing throughout the year. Proper communication about expectations and specific needs can contribute to a smooth maintenance process and a well-maintained outdoor space.

Common Park Landscape Maintenance Jobs
Lawn Mowing - regular trimming to keep grass healthy and neat.
Weed Control - removal of weeds to maintain a tidy landscape.
Tree Trimming - shaping and pruning trees for safety and appearance.
Flower Bed Maintenance - edging, weeding, and mulching for vibrant garden beds.
Irrigation Services - installation and upkeep of watering systems for optimal hydration.
Seasonal Cleanup - removing debris and preparing landscapes for changing seasons.
Park Landscape Maintenance Questions
What types of landscape maintenance services are available? Services include lawn mowing, trimming, edging, weed control, and seasonal cleanup to keep outdoor spaces tidy and healthy.
How often should a property be maintained? Maintenance frequency depends on the landscape’s needs and local climate, typically ranging from weekly to monthly schedules.
What are common projects for landscape upkeep? Projects often involve lawn care, shrub and tree trimming, flower bed maintenance, and debris removal to enhance curb appeal.
What should property owners consider when planning landscape maintenance? Consider the specific plants, yard size, and desired appearance to determine the appropriate scope and frequency of services.
